176/552 = ≈31.88%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
A fraction like 176/552, or about 31.88%, could describe the share of people in a survey who chose one answer. It might also represent roughly one-third of a group, such as 176 out of 552 students bringing lunch from home.
To picture 31.88% quickly, imagine a whole divided into 10 equal parts: it is a little more than 3 of those parts. It is also slightly less than one-third, since one-third is about 33.33%.
A common mistake is treating 31.88% as if it were 31.88 whole items. The percentage describes a portion of the total, while 176/552 shows that portion as a fraction using actual counts.
